Job Summary: We are seeking a skilled and reliable Electronics Onsite Technician to provide hands-on technical support, installation, maintenance, and troubleshooting of electronic equipment at client locations. The ideal candidate should have a strong foundation in electronics, problem-solving skills, and the ability to work independently in field environments. Key Responsibilities: Install, configure, and test electronic systems and devices onsite, including sensors, controllers, wiring, and related hardware. Perform regular preventive maintenance and inspection of installed equipment to ensure optimal performance. Troubleshoot and repair malfunctioning devices using diagnostic tools and techniques. Respond to service requests and provide timely resolutions to minimize downtime. Coordinate with remote support and engineering teams to escalate and resolve complex technical issues. Document site visits, service activities, and repair logs accurately. Maintain proper inventory of spare parts, tools, and consumables. Follow safety guidelines and ensure compliance with all company and client site protocols. Educate clients or end-users on basic equipment handling and maintenance procedures. Qualifications: Diploma or ITI in Electronics / Electrical Engineering or equivalent technical qualification. 2–4 years of experience in field service or electronics maintenance (preferably in automation, parking systems, or security equipment). Strong understanding of electronic circuits, wiring, and soldering. Ability to read technical manuals, schematics, and wiring diagrams.
